Rex Tillerson Net Worth: Salary, Exxon, and Riches

Rex Tillerson net worth reflects decades of operational leadership in global energy markets. As a former Secretary of State and long time executive at ExxonMobil, his financial position combines salary, bonuses, deferred compensation, and ongoing equity grants.

Below is a structured overview of key financial indicators tied to his public career, followed by deeper exploration of specific themes.

Category Details Value or Status Notes
Primary Career Long tenure at ExxonMobil Chairman and CEO (2006–2017) Built reputation in oil and gas operations
Government Role U.S. Secretary of State 2017–2018 Public salary subject to standard GS scales
Estimated Net Worth Range reported by media $150 million to $200 million Driven by ExxonMobil equity and deferred compensation
PostGovernment Activities Private investments and board roles Energy advisory and infrastructure funds Continued engagement in global projects

Career Trajectory and Compensation Structure

Executive Leadership at ExxonMobil

Rex Tillerson net worth grew significantly during his time as a top executive at ExxonMobil. Base salary was complemented by substantial bonuses tied to operational performance, production targets, and reserve replacement metrics.

Deferred compensation plans and long term equity awards played a major role in aligning his interests with long term shareholder value. These elements formed the backbone of his reported wealth.

Secretary of State Tenure and Financial Impact

Public Salary and Allowances

As Secretary of State, Rex Tillerson received a public salary consistent with the highest level of the Executive Schedule. Travel, security, and office allowances supported the operational demands of the role but did not substantially alter his net worth.

The transition from corporate executive to cabinet officer involved changes in income structure, but not the scale of overall wealth accumulation seen during his corporate years.

PostGovernment Portfolio and Investments

Energy Advisory and Infrastructure

After leaving government service, Rex Tillerson maintained involvement in the energy sector through advisory roles and strategic investments. These activities provided continued exposure to project finance and capital intensive infrastructure.

Board memberships and consultancy arrangements added layers to his professional income, though most of his net worth remained anchored to earlier equity holdings.

Key Takeaways for Understanding Rex Tillerson Net Worth

  • Corporate executive career at ExxonMobil formed the foundation of his wealth.
  • Deferred compensation and equity awards were larger contributors than annual salary.
  • Government service changed income sources but did not dramatically increase net worth.
  • PostGovernment activities maintained professional relevance and portfolio management.

FAQ

Reader questions

How did Rex Tillerson build his net worth primarily?

His primary wealth came from decades at ExxonMobil, where salary, bonuses, and long term equity awards generated the bulk of his assets.

Did serving as Secretary of State significantly increase his net worth?

No, the role provided a steady public salary and allowances but did not add major new sources of wealth compared to his corporate background.

What happens to his net worth after leaving government?

He remains engaged through advisory roles and investments, allowing his portfolio to grow or be managed rather than substantially expanded.

Are there public disclosures of his exact net worth figures?

Specific figures are estimates by media and watchdog organizations, since detailed personal financial filings are not continuously published.
